Belly Fat Exercises with Resistance Bands: A Complete Guide

Are you looking to shed stubborn belly fat and achieve a toned midsection? Resistance bands might just be the secret weapon you need. These versatile fitness tools are not only affordable and portable but also incredibly effective for targeting core muscles and burning fat. In this article, we’ll explore a variety of belly fat exercises with resistance bands that can help you reach your fitness goals.

Why Resistance Bands Are Effective for Belly Fat

Resistance bands are a fantastic addition to any workout routine, especially when it comes to targeting belly fat. Unlike traditional weights, resistance bands provide continuous tension throughout the entire range of motion, which helps engage your core muscles more effectively. This constant tension forces your body to work harder, leading to increased calorie burn and muscle activation.

Additionally, resistance bands are excellent for improving posture and stability, which are crucial for a strong and toned core. By incorporating resistance band exercises into your routine, you can enhance your overall fitness while specifically targeting the abdominal area.

Top Belly Fat Exercises with Resistance Bands

Here are some of the most effective belly fat exercises with resistance bands that you can try at home or at the gym:

1. Resistance Band Russian Twists

This exercise targets the obliques and helps tone the sides of your waist. Sit on the floor with your legs bent and feet flat. Loop the resistance band around your feet and hold the ends with both hands. Lean back slightly and twist your torso to the right, then to the left, while keeping your core engaged.

2. Standing Resistance Band Side Bends

Stand with your feet shoulder-width apart and step on the resistance band with one foot. Hold the other end of the band with the opposite hand. Slowly bend sideways, lowering the band toward your knee, then return to the starting position. Repeat on the other side.

3. Resistance Band Woodchoppers

This full-body exercise engages your core, shoulders, and arms. Anchor the resistance band at a high point and stand with your side to the anchor. Hold the band with both hands and pull it diagonally across your body, as if you’re chopping wood. Repeat on the other side.

4. Resistance Band Plank Rows

Get into a plank position with the resistance band looped around your hands. Pull one hand toward your chest while keeping your core tight and your body stable. Alternate sides to complete the set.

5. Resistance Band Leg Raises

Lie on your back with the resistance band looped around your feet. Hold the ends of the band with your hands and keep your legs straight. Slowly raise your legs to a 90-degree angle, then lower them back down without touching the floor.

Tips for Maximizing Results

To get the most out of your belly fat exercises with resistance bands, follow these tips:

  • Focus on proper form to avoid injury and ensure you’re targeting the right muscles.
  • Combine resistance band exercises with a balanced diet and regular cardio for optimal fat loss.
  • Gradually increase the resistance of the bands as you get stronger to continue challenging your muscles.
  • Stay consistent with your workouts and aim for at least 3-4 sessions per week.

Benefits of Using Resistance Bands for Belly Fat

Resistance bands offer numerous benefits beyond just burning belly fat. They are lightweight, portable, and can be used anywhere, making them perfect for home workouts or travel. Additionally, they are suitable for all fitness levels, from beginners to advanced athletes, and can be easily adjusted to increase or decrease intensity.

Using resistance bands also helps improve flexibility, balance, and coordination, which are essential for overall fitness. By incorporating these tools into your routine, you can achieve a well-rounded workout that targets multiple muscle groups while focusing on your core.

How to Incorporate Resistance Bands into Your Routine

If you’re new to resistance bands, start with lighter bands and gradually work your way up to higher resistance levels. Begin with 2-3 sets of 10-15 repetitions for each exercise, and increase the intensity as you build strength. You can also combine resistance band exercises with other forms of exercise, such as yoga, Pilates, or weight training, for a more comprehensive workout.

Remember to warm up before starting your workout and cool down afterward to prevent injury and improve recovery. Stretching and foam rolling can also help enhance flexibility and reduce muscle soreness.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

When performing belly fat exercises with resistance bands, it’s important to avoid common mistakes that can hinder your progress or lead to injury. Some of these mistakes include:

  • Using too much resistance, which can compromise your form and increase the risk of injury.
  • Not engaging your core muscles during exercises, which reduces their effectiveness.
  • Rushing through movements instead of focusing on controlled, deliberate motions.
  • Neglecting other aspects of fitness, such as cardio and strength training, which are essential for overall fat loss.
